>> hello,
>> indian railways has issued the circular on 19th, March, 2015
>> instructing all the zones to issue the identity card to physically
>> handicapped persons to facilitate them to book the concessional
>> Eticket and also from the ticket counters authrised by them.
>> initially, this project was launched on pilot basis in northern
>> railways.  you can download this circular from here:

>>> Hi all, one of my friends is facing difficulty in booking the railway
>>> ticket with the help of his railway concession certificate. He made
>>> this concession certificate last month as per the revised performa.
>>> But my friend has been advised to make a new ID card from commercial
>>> office of railway, and also told that these certificates are no longer
>>> valid.
>>> Is there any such notification or circular from the railway? Does it
>>> necessary to make this new card in order  to avail concession on
>>> booking the railway ticket? --
